#dda864 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dda864 is composed of 86.7% red, 65.9%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24% magenta, 54.8%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 33.7 degrees, a saturation of 64% and a lightness of 62.9%. #dda864 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c8 with #bb5100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#dda864 color description : Soft orange.
#dda864 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dda864 has RGB values of R:221, G:168,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.55,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14526564.

Shades and Tints of #dda864
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060401 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dda864
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a19e is the less saturated color, while #faac47 is the most saturated one.
